How to Fix iBooks on Jailbroken iOS 5 on iPad, iPhone, and iPod Touch

The iOS 5 firmware has been released can be jailbroken using Redsn0w and Sn0wbreeze. Unfortunately, Apple’s iBooks is not working on jailbroken iPad, iPhone, and iPod Touch running on tethered or semi tethered iOS 5. We are hearing numerous reports from various iPad, iPhone and iPod touch users regarding their turbulent experience, conveniently crashing every time they are trying to launch iBooks on their iOS 5-powered devices. Well, the good news is, a temporary solution / workaround is available to fix this error.

According to iH8sn0w – the main man behind Sn0wbreeze iPhone / iPad jailbreak tool – the issue was dealing with how Redsn0w or Sn0wbreeze did sandbox patches in the kernel. And for those of you who aren’t aware, sandbox is a security measure that is used to ensure iOS apps such as the Safari mobile browser don’t have access to personal information or system files. Anyway, you can check the tutorial posted below on how to fix iBooks on jailbroken iOS 5 on iPad, iPhone, and iPod Touch:

Note: This tutorial requires you to have iFile, a jailbreak app available in Cydia Store under BigBoss repo. It is a paid app, but is very useful and worth every penny.

Steps to fix iBooks on Jailbroken iOS 5
Step 1: First, you will need to uninstall iBooks on your jailbroken iOS device (or use this iTunes link to download iBooks). Make sure you don’t open the app just yet as we are going to apply the fix first.
Step 2: Now you have to launch iFile and the you have to copy iBooks.app from /var/mobile/Applications/(iBook’s folder)/ and paste it to /Applications. You can use SBSettings, or just check every folder to identify the correct iBooks folder. This process is quite if you don’t have much App Store apps installed on your iOS device.
Step 3: After pasting iBooks.app, just simply tap on /Applications/iBooks.app/Info.plist and then select the property list editor. Select the CFBundleIdentifier and then change its file name from com.apple.iBooks to com.apple.iBooksFix.
Step 4: Exit iFile and then Respring your iOS device.
Step 5: Now you have to delete the original iBooks app (the one with the rounded corners) and keep the newly installed square iBooks app.

iBooks on jailbroken iOS 5 is fixed! However, since this is just a temporary fix, there’s no way you will be able to sync your iOS device to iTunes, upload your .epub files, or purchase eBooks.

How To Fix iBooks App Anti-Jailbreaking Code in iOS 4.2.1 Greenpois0n Jailbreak Without Jailbreaking

Well it seems like the Cupertino, California-based Apple is testing a new anti-jailbreak code, and they embedded it on its software updates. Recently, the iPhone maker launched an update to iBooks app for iPhone, iPad, and iPod Touch. And as a result, Apple disables iBooks on jailbroken iPhone, iPad, and iPod Touch.

Apple does not open digital books loaded with DRM on the jailbroken iOS. iPhone hacker and an integral member of the iPhone Dev Team Comex reported that the updated iBooks app is trying to analyze the iOS system to determine if its jailbroken or not through executing improperly signed binary. If the app figured out that the iOS is jailbroken then it does not open. However, the good news is that, a new Cydia tweak has been released in order to resolve the iBooks app issues. The name of this tweak is iBooks Fix and you can download it in Cydia App store for free of cost. The solution available in Cydia Store fixes the iBooks on iOS 4.2.1 devices jailbroken using the Greenpois0n without needing restore and re-jailbreak.

Here is how to install iBooks Fix.
Step 1: Tap on Cydia icon and go to Manage -> Sources -> Edit -> Add.
Step 2: Type the address of Insanelyi repositr0y “ http://repo.insanelyi.com “ and tap on “Add Source”.
Step 3: Search for “iBooks Fix” and install it.

After you have installed this tweak on your jailbroken iOS device you can now open iBooks app and access all your DRM-filled books on your jailbroken iPhone, iPod touch, and iPad.

Apple’s iBooks App Gets Updated, Adds New Features

Apple has updated its iBooks app for the iPhone, iPad and iPod Touch, and the latest version, iBooks 1.5 brings a new range of features to Apple’s eBook app, which include a new nighttime reading theme that is designed to make it easier to read books in the dark.

Other new features include a new full screen layout, a new range of fonts, which include Athelas, Charter, Iowan, and Seravek, plus some new classic covers for the public domain books and more. You can find out full details of everything is new in iBooks 1.5 over at iTunes, and the app is available as a free download for the iPhone, iPad and iPod Touch.
